What perks can you offer on cruises? +
It depends on the cruise line, but through the Virtuoso Voyages program, travelers booking with a Virtuoso advisor can receive some genuinely special benefits beyond the standard package. Perks include dedicated onboard hosts, a private welcome reception, exclusive shore excursions (from VIP tours to outings with a private car and driver), shipboard credits, and specialty dining options. It's one of those situations where booking through an advisor really does make a tangible difference to your experience onboard.

Does using a travel advisor cost more than booking direct? +
Not typically, and sometimes we can do even better. In some cases I'm able to access a preferred rate that's lower than what's publicly available. More often, the rate is the same as booking direct, but comes with extras you simply wouldn't get on your own: complimentary breakfast, specialty dining credits, hotel credits, or cruise credits. So you're either paying less, or getting more for the same price.

Which airline programs do you search? +
All major airline loyalty programs and transferable point programs, including Chase Ultimate Rewards, Amex Membership Rewards, Capital One Miles, Citi ThankYou Points, and Bilt Rewards, as well as airline-specific programs.

What's included in the award research? +
You receive six deliverables: a points and program summary, award seat availability report, flight option comparison, transfer plan, step-by-step booking instructions, and a backup strategy in case availability changes. All recommendations are evaluated against cash pricing to confirm value.
